Meeting Point and Accessibility

liverpool-heritage-history-culture-walking-tour-shore-excursion

Guests meet at Cruise Liverpool, Cruise Terminal, Gate 2 Princes Parade, Liverpool L3 1DL, UK, the designated meeting point for this tour. The tour is accessible, allowing for wheelchair users, strollers, and service animals. Comfortable, non-slip shoes are recommended due to uneven surfaces. Children under 16 must be accompanied by an adult, and well-behaved dogs are welcome.

Itinerary and Photo Opportunities

liverpool-heritage-history-culture-walking-tour-shore-excursion

The Liverpool Heritage Walking Tour offers guests a comprehensive itinerary that showcases the city’s most iconic landmarks and architectural marvels.

Participants can expect to visit historic sites like the Town Hall, St. George’s Hall, and the Albert Dock, learning about their significance and the compelling stories they hold.

The tour also includes photo stops at striking locations, allowing visitors to capture their experience.

Along the way, the knowledgeable guides provide insights into Liverpool’s vibrant culture, from its Titanic connections to the enduring legacy of the Beatles.

The well-paced tour ensures ample time for questions and exploration.
